Novel idiopathic DCM-related SCN5A variants localised in DI-S4 predispose electrical disorders by reducing peak sodium current density
Conclusion
Our results suggest that the iDCM-related SCN5A variants in the DI-S4 could predispose electrical disorders by reducing peak sodium current density.
